A man stabbed a passenger on a train at a south London station and then
chased people shouting: "I want to kill a Muslim", the Daily Mirror
reported on Monday, in an
incident police said was not
"terrorism-related."
Shoppers and other travelers ran away as the man roamed the streets for
up to 15 minutes, the newspaper reported.
"A man has been arrested after a man was seriously assaulted at
Forest Hill station this afternoon," British Transport Police said in a
statement on their website.
"We are investigating the circumstances of the Forest Hill incident,
but at this time we are not treating it as terrorism-related."
